QT数据库图表:实现数据可视化分析与展示(qt数据库图表)

随着数据的不断增长和复杂性的不断提高,数据分析与展示变得愈发重要。对于企业而言,通过数据可视化分析和展示,能够更好地了解企业运营状态、分析业务状况、以及为企业决策提供参考。本文介绍如何使用qt数据库图表实现数据可视化分析和展示。

创新互联建站2013年开创至今,先为兴宁等服务建站,兴宁等地企业,进行企业商务咨询服务。为兴宁企业网站制作PC+手机+微官网三网同步一站式服务解决您的所有建站问题。

QT数据库图表简介

QT数据库图表是一种用于展示数据库数据的控件,其功能强大,使用方便,适用于多种数据库类型。它能够将多种不同类型的数据以图表的方式呈现出来,例如折线图、饼图、柱状图等。QT数据库图表可以让用户更加清晰地看到数据之间的关系和趋势,帮助用户更好地了解数据分析的结果。

QT数据库图表的实现步骤

为了实现数据的可视化分析和展示,我们需要采用以下步骤:

1. 数据库的连接和读取

我们需要连接数据库,并读取需要分析的数据。QT支持多种数据库类型,例如MySQL、SQLite、Oracle等。在连接数据库的过程中,我们需要指定数据库的类型、IP地址、端口号、用户名和密码等信息。然后,我们需要编写代码将需要的数据读取出来。

2. 数据的处理和分析

读取数据之后,我们需要对数据进行处理和分析。数据的处理将数据进行清洗、去重、转换等操作,以便后续的可视化分析。数据的分析则需要根据具体的业务需要进行,例如数据的统计、排序、分组等。

3. 数据的可视化展示

在数据分析的基础上,我们需要将数据以图表的方式展示出来。QT数据库图表支持多种图表类型,例如折线图、饼图、柱状图等。我们可以根据具体的业务需要选择相应的图表类型。在选择图表类型之后,我们需要将数据绑定到图表上,并设置相应的标题、横轴和纵轴标题、数据轴刻度值等信息。

4. 数据的实时更新

随着数据的不断更新和变化,我们需要对数据进行实时更新。在QT数据库图表中,我们可以使用定时器实现数据的实时更新。我们可以设置定时器的时间间隔,每隔一定的时间自动更新最新数据,从而保持数据的实时性。

QT数据库图表是一种强大的数据可视化分析和展示工具,它具有使用方便、功能强大、支持多种数据库类型等特点。通过QT数据库图表的使用,我们可以更好地进行数据分析和展示,从而提高企业的管理水平和决策效率。

相关问题拓展阅读:

  • qt怎样创建数据库以及数据库的操作
  • QT查询mysql数据库中表格是否存在怎么操作

qt怎样创建数据库以及数据库的操作

qt可以实现连接各种数据库,这里介绍qt自带的一种数据库(Qsqlite)

#include

#include

#include

#include

#include

#include

#include

staticboolcreateConnection()

{QSqlDatabasedb=QSqlDatabase::addDatabase(“QSQLITE”);

db.setDatabaseName(“mytest.db”);

if(!db.open())

returnfalse;

QSqlQueryquery;

//query.exec(QObject::tr(“createtablestudent(idintprimarykey,namevchar)”));

//query.exec(QObject::tr(“insertintostudentvalues(0,’刘’)”));

////query.exec(QObject::tr(“insertintostudentvalues(1,’刚’)”));

//query.exec(QObject::tr(“insertintostudentvalues(2,’红’)”));

//query.prepare(“insertintostudentvalues(?,?)”);

//

//通过下面这段代码可以实现向数据库插入变量

//

QVariantListages;

intx1,x2,x3,x4;

x1=12;

x2=13;

x3=14;

x4=15;

ages

query.addBindValue(ages);

QVariantListnames;

names

query.addBindValue(names);

if(!query.execBatch())//进行批处理,如果出错陆哗裤就输出错误

qDebug()

returntrue;

}

#endif//DATABASE_H

然后用QSqlTableModel实现数据库数据显示

QT查询mysql数据库中表格是否存在怎么操作

1、sql语句判或旁断数据库表是否存在:

  sql:select * from user_all_tables where table_name=’tableName’

  如果结果衫誉橡为空则表示不存在,如何结果不为空则表示存在;

  2、java如何判断数据库表是否存在

  可以利用上面的sql,执行获取结果,相应的java代码如下:

  String helperName= delegator.getGroupHelperName(“com.asiainfo”);

  SQLProcessor sqlProcessor= new SQLProcessor(helperName);

  String sql = “select * from user_all_tables where table_name='”+table+”‘”;

  ResultSet rsTables =sqlProcessor.executeQuery(sql);

  if(rsTables.next()){

  Debug.logWarning(“table:”+table+” exists”, module);

  }else{

 虚行 Debug.logWarning(“table:”+table+” does not exist”, module);

  }

关于qt数据库图表的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。

香港服务器选创新互联,2H2G首月10元开通。
创新互联(www.cdcxhl.com)互联网服务提供商,拥有超过10年的服务器租用、服务器托管、云服务器、虚拟主机、网站系统开发经验。专业提供云主机、虚拟主机、域名注册、VPS主机、云服务器、香港云服务器、免备案服务器等。

分享文章:QT数据库图表:实现数据可视化分析与展示(qt数据库图表)
标题链接:http://www.hantingmc.com/qtweb/news42/141192.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联